Output d84d594972455fc3e51f24dddf984ec6d7f94c211a269353aef3040c62f76779:70

value
24933130
script pubkey
OP_0 OP_PUSHBYTES_20 67eb309e03fdb270c99a1c44d5d14fc188ccf565
address
bc1qvl4np8srlke8pjv6r3zdt520cxyveat9780ahk
transaction
d84d594972455fc3e51f24dddf984ec6d7f94c211a269353aef3040c62f76779
spent
true